Ensuring The Longevity Of Your Roller Shutters: Essential Maintenance Tips

Roller shutters are a popular choice for many homes and businesses due to their durability, security, and aesthetic appeal However, like any other mechanical system, roller shutters require regular maintenance to ensure they continue to function properly and serve their intended purpose Proper maintenance not only prolongs the life of your roller shutters but also prevents costly repairs in the future In this article, we will discuss essential maintenance tips to keep your roller shutters in top condition.

1 Regular Cleaning
One of the simplest yet most effective maintenance tasks for roller shutters is regular cleaning Dust, dirt, and debris can accumulate on the surface of the shutters, affecting their smooth operation To clean your roller shutters, use a mild detergent and water solution to wash away any buildup You can also use a soft brush or cloth to gently scrub the surface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ners as they can damage the finish of the shutters.

2 Lubrication
Another important maintenance task for roller shutters is lubrication Over time, the moving parts of the shutters can become stiff and squeaky due to friction To prevent this, apply a small amount of lubricant to the tracks, hinges, and rollers of the shutters regularly Be sure to use a lubricant that is specifically designed for use on roller shutters to avoid gumming up the mechanisms.

3 Inspection
Regular inspection of your roller shutters is crucial to identify any potential issues before they become major problems Check the shutters for any signs of damage, such as dents, cracks, or rust roller shutters maintenance. Also, ensure that the bolts, screws, and other fasteners are securely tightened If you notice any issues during your inspection, address them promptly to prevent further damage.

4 Adjustments
Over time, the tension of the springs and cables in your roller shutters may need to be adjusted to maintain proper operation If you notice that your shutters are not opening or closing smoothly, or if they are making strange noises, it may be time to adjust the tension This task is best left to a professional to ensure it is done correctly and safely.

5 Weather Stripping
The weather stripping on your roller shutters plays a crucial role in keeping out drafts, moisture, and debris Inspect the weather stripping regularly for signs of wear and tear, such as cracking or peeling If you notice any damage, replace the weather stripping as soon as possible to maintain the energy efficiency of your shutters.
